Transaction f943198b05612c4370dafbad60ec86b401b33911cb526d882eb817adeb0b1c63
1 Input
1 Output
-
f943198b05612c4370dafbad60ec86b401b33911cb526d882eb817adeb0b1c63:0
- value
- 150147
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b852dfa5c414b8eddb00ad8074f361a607592cb OP_EQUAL
- address
- 3Cx8acuMbmTViem9VCudG8y6paftLREagg